Subchronic Exposure to 2,3,7,8-Tetrachlorodibenzo-p-dioxin Modulates the Pathophysiology of Endometriosis in the Cynomolgus Monkey
Subchronic exposure to 2,3,7,8-tetrachlorodibenzo-p-dioxin modulated endometriosis pathophysiology in cynomolgus monkeys by influencing implant survival and growth in a dose-dependent manner.
